Welcome to Wilmslow Town FC

Wilmslow Town Football Club is one of the largest junior football clubs in Cheshire. Wilmslow Town FC runs Under 16s, Under 15s, Under 14s, Under 13s, Under 12s, Under 11s, Under 10s and Under 9s teams, as well as a veterans team. Our junior sides play in the Timperley & District Junior Football League and we are represented by our seniors in the Cheshire Veterans Football League.
